How to prune roses? Pruning skills and methods of roses
Pruning skills of rose branches: when pruning, control the upward growth of thick branches, cut off the top tip at an appropriate position, promote the growth of roses, inhibit the rise of flowering parts, and avoid the phenomenon of bare lower branches. Pruning twice in summer and winter can make the branches ventilated and transparent, enhance the light, and concentrate nutrients on the flowering branches.
